Published September 14th, 2006 in GeneralI was inspired by this recent post on The Wednesday Chef yesterday and made Bill Granger’s Coconut Bread.
Yummy!
I think next time (and there will be a next time) I will try toasting the coconut first to add a little more deep coconut flavor and a little more texture. I used sweetened flaked coconut, but I’ll also have to try the unsweetened kind. I thought I had some but it must not have survived the move.
Overall, this was very tasty, though, and definitely something that I’ll be adding to my often-made list.
